JAY SOM Shares "One More Time, Please" Music Video

Bay Area-based artist Jay Som - a.k.a. multi-instrumentalist, singer, songwriter and producer Melina Duterte - released her stunning break-out album Everybody Works earlier this year. The record debuted on the Billboard Independent Album and Heatseekers charts, and earned her a "Best New Music" review from Pitchfork, as well as international accolades from the likes of New York Times, The New Yorker, NPRRolling Stone and many more. Today, Duterte shares a music video for Everybody Works highlight "One More Time, Please."

We wanted to honor the heaviness of Melina’s lyrics by channeling the essence of madness many feel while attempting to live up to societal standards, behaviors or even personal obsessions. This madness can become mentally and physically enslaving. We follow the main character as she attempts to satisfy these standards/obsessions until she realizes her obsession with such is more of an internalized threat. This realization of her own obsessive state guides her to find her own peace of mind and acceptance of herself.
— Christopher Good and Andreina Byrne (Co-writers, directors and producers of "One More Time, Please")

SOCCER MOMMY Shares New Song via NPR, Announces Mini-Album out 8/4 on Fat Possum

Soccer Mommy - the project of nineteen-year-old Nashville native, NYU student and musical wunderkind Sophie Allison - has built a reputation as an incredibly exciting DIY artist, recording her own songs and releasing them for free on Bandcamp over the last few years. Today, Soccer Mommy announces that she has signed withFat Possum Records and will release a mini-album entitled Collection on August 4th. Comprising of reworked versions of some of her best Bandcamp releases, as well as a few new songs written, mixed and produced by Sophie herself, Collection is the perfect introduction to Soccer Mommy's sound: quietly catchy, surprisingly confrontational, the kind of music that sneaks up on you and makes a permanent first impression. The songs on Collection portray an artist fully-formed, mature far beyond her age. Sophie sings of toxic relationships, infatuations, and all the experiences of being a teenage girl. There's a freedom and a joy to this music, and Collection stands as an excellent introduction to a powerful new voice. Critics may decry the end of guitar music, same as they have for over thirty years. The fact remains that as long as records like Collection exist, there will be no shortage of young artists bashing their hearts out on guitars for years to come. These perfect pop gems have power, and Collection is destined to be a favorite record.

Thundercat Announces Extensive North American Headline Tour; 'Drunk' Out Now

Thundercat released his critically acclaimed third full length album Drunk earlier this year on Brainfeeder Records. Since announcing the album in January with the single “Show You The Way” featuring Michael McDonald & Kenny Loggins, Thundercat has played shows across the world including a sold out North American winter tour, sold out shows across Europe and Japan, and festivals including Coachella.

Today, Thundercat announced a headline North American tour in addition to his previously announced appearances at festivals including FYF Fest in Los Angeles and Afropunk in New York City. Solange Adds Second Guggenheim Show; Gucci Mane & Zaytoven Piano Nights Streams Tonight || RBMA NYC

As part of the Red Bull Music Academy Festival New York, Piano Nights: Gucci Mane and Zaytoven will bring the rapper-producer duo of Gucci Mane and Zaytoven together again to deliver throwback piano bar renditions of some of their most famous tunes—voice  (Gucci) and piano (Zay). Fans around the globe can experience the intimate concert live in its entirety tonight, May 16 at 9pm ET via Red Bull Music & Culture’s YouTube channel, and can watch it on demand for 30 days. The month long music series Red Bull Music Academy Festival New York heads into the final week of the 2017 installment and today, Red Bull Music Academy and The Solomon R. Guggenheim Museum announced a second performance of Solange: An Ode To. Tickets for the originally announced show sold out immediately and will take place this Thursday, May 18 at 6:30pm. The second show will take place at the museum at 3pm on the same day. Tickets for the 3pm show can be purchased at 12pm ET today, May 16 via https://nyc.redbullmusicacademy.com/events/solange-an-ode-to.

With the 2016 release of A Seat at the Table, Solange Knowles earned widespread commercial and critical acclaim—a long-awaited coronation for one of R&B’s most inspiring talents. Undeniably intense, politically galvanizing, and sonically beautiful, the album is a document of personal and universal struggle, with Solange’s vocals and lyrical perspective matched by peerless funk, soul, and R&B backing. Now Solange adds to this triumph with An Ode To, an interdisciplinary performance piece and meditation on themes from A Seat at the Table that incorporates movement, installation, and experimentally reconstructed musical arrangements. Presented in the museum’s iconic rotunda as part of the Red Bull Music Academy Festival New York 2017, An Ode Toshowcases familiar and reimaginedversions of songs from A Seat at the Table and continues the Guggenheim’s rich program of groundbreaking performances.

Clark Shares Dizzying "Peak Magnetic" Video - On Tour Now With Com Truise

Clark can now preview a new visual cut for stand out album track and live favorite ‘Peak Magnetic’. The topsy-turvy, vertigo-inducing video unrolls with the momentum of the track and dancers Kiani del Valle and Sophia Ndaba who are currently touring with Clark and his awe inspiring live show featuring the choreography of Melanie Lane.

 

The video is directed by Sander Houtkruijer. Sander has risen to prominence via visuals for artists like Floating Points and Matias Aguayo.

I wanted to create a distinct world that these two characters inhabit, but at the same time showing that this world is their own creation. This world has no traceable origin, but is more like a 3D test rendering, a kind of map, or template, both for itself and for other worlds outside of it. Also in accordance with Clark’s music, I wanted it to throw together different, seemingly opposing elements, like synthetic vs organic and live-action vs animation, and see how they can contrast with each other, and at some points, sync together, to create a new whole in which all these tensions dissolve.
— Sander Hautkrujier

Death Peak, released last month has proven to be one of his most lauded to date. It deftly weaves together the various threads of his extensive work, intertwining euphoric melodies and visceral rhythms of warehouse rave with newer vocal and choral elements.
